10th Battalion Royal Ranger Regiment gearing for Ops Kris Parang/Gabungan
KUCHING: The 10th Battalion Royal Ranger Regiment is gearing up for duty at Operasi Kris Parang/Gabungan along West Kalimantan- Sarawak border in July.
Its commanding officer Lt Colonel Azman Zainuddin said it would be a similar operation to the one they did last year when 250 men were assigned.
“The operation last year ran from July 2 until October 2. We shall be taking part again this year,” he told reporters after the 37th anniversary assembly at Muara Tuang Camp in Kota Samarahan yesterday.
